A CCD detector system built around the Thomson TH 7882 chip has recently been acquired for use at the 102 em telescope at the Vainu Bappu Observatory (VBO). The chip has a coating for enhanced ultraviolet sensitivity, making it a viable system for two-dimensional imaging in the wavelength range of ˜0.3-1 μm. Observations of stars in open cluster M67 standard field were carried out on two nights with U, B, V, R filters to evaluate the performance of the system. The use of this chip for standard astronomical photometry, to our knowledge, has not been reported earlier.
